longspur in British English
any of a genus (Calcarius, family Emberizidae) of northern passerine birds distinguished by their long hind claws noun: any of several fringillid birds of the genus Calcarius of tundra or prairie regions of North America, characterized by a long, spurlike hind claw on each foot noun: any of various Arctic and North American buntings of the genera Calcarius and Rhyncophanes, all of which have a long claw on the hind toe |
